A stock has an expected return of 11 percent, its beta is 1.20, and the risk-free rate is 4.4 percent. What must the expected re
Drupady [299]

Answer:

Expected market return = 9.8%

Explanation:

The expected return on the market can be worked out using the Capital Asset Pricing Model.

<em>The capital asset pricing model is a risk-based model. Here, the return on equity is dependent on the level of reaction of the the equity to changes in the return on a market portfolio. These changes are captured as systematic risk. The magnitude by which a stock is affected by systematic risk is measured by beta. </em>

Under CAPM, Ke= Rf + β(Rm-Rf)

Rf-risk-free rate (treasury bill rate)- 4.4%

β= Beta - 1.20

Rm= Return on market.- ?

Applying this model, we have

11%= 4.4%+ (R-4.4%)×1.20

0.11-0.044= 1.20×(R-0.04)

0.07 = 1.20R-0.048

Collect like terms

0.07+0.048 = 1.2R

Divide both sides by 1.20

R= (0.07+0.048)/1.20

R=9.83%

Expected market return = 9.8%

<h3>What Are Barriers to Entry? </h3>

A term used in economics and business to describe variables that can deter or make it difficult for newcomers to enter a market or industry sector and so limit competition is "barriers to entry." These might include prohibitive startup fees, bureaucratic roadblocks, or other barriers that make it difficult for new rivals to enter a market. Existing businesses win from entrance barriers because they preserve their market share and capacity to make money.

There are four main types of barriers to entry:

  • legal (patents/licenses),
  • technical (high start-up costs/monopoly/technical knowledge),
  • strategic (predatory pricing/first mover),
  • brand loyalty.

Most people think of patents as temporary entry barriers put in place by the government. Patent protection, however, typically restricts access rather than blocking it. A business may enter a market that is protected as long as its product complies with a minimum standard of novelty and does not violate any active patents.
